We are a very small not for profit community organisation and we already use Events Calendar on our site. We are seriously looking to move our bookings and ticketing on line and Event Tickets Plus seems the logical route to go.
Questions:
1. After some research it would seem that the workflow lineup would be:
Events Calendar -> Tickets Plus -> Woo Commerce -> Card Gateway (probably Go Cardless)
Does this make sense to you? I’m just worrying about the interactions between the plugins but what I’ve read suggests it should work.
2. It would seem sensible to put the shop into a sub domain even though this means changing our current SSL arrangements. Will we be able to put the Events on the main domain and then link across to the sub domain for ticketing and payment? If so, great! If not, thoughts?

April 24, 2017 at 3:25 pm #1273694CliffMemberHi, Paul.
Event Tickets Plus with WooCommerce and your payment gateway of choice should work just fine.
However, I don’t see the reasoning for putting your main site with events and such on the main domain and your WooCommerce on a subdomain. It’s not designed to work like this and it wouldn’t work for our plugin(s) either.
